V597 DDF is a 2000 Chrysler-jeep Grand Voyager in Silver with a 2,499cc diesel engine. This vehicle has been through 14 MOT tests with a personal pass rate of 92.9%.
Across all 2000 Chrysler-jeep Grand Voyager models, the average MOT pass rate is 62.7% with a typical mileage of 102,922 miles. This particular vehicle has performed better than the average for its year.
The most common reason a Chrysler-jeep Grand Voyager fails its MOT is parking brake: efficiency below requirements, accounting for 6,052 recorded failures. If you're considering buying V597 DDF, it's worth having these areas checked by a mechanic before committing.
The Chrysler-jeep Grand Voyager typically stays on UK roads for around 29 years. At 26 years old, this Chrysler-jeep Grand Voyager is approaching the upper end of the typical lifespan for this model.
